Rattota

Rattota east of Matale is the gateway to the Riverston pass, sometimes called Sri Lanka’s second Horton Plains. The Riverston area is crowded with places which recently became linked to the Ramayana in promotion of the so-called Ramayana Trail. Rattota is home to one of the very few Hindu temples in Sri Lanka dedicated to Lord Rama, whereas most Tamil temples on the island first and foremost honour Shiva or one of his family members. To be more precise: There is another Rama temple in Colombo, built during recent years by the Mumbai based Chinmaya mission, and some small local shrines in the tea plantation areas are dedicated to Lord Rama, too. But the Kovil in Rattota is Sri Lanka’s only bigger Rama temple with a local tradition of Rama worship.
